* Use imported targets instead of qt5_use_modulesHeiko Becker2017-07-29
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| From Qt's documentation: "This macro is obsolete. Use target_link_libraries with IMPORTED targets instead." It's only recommended with cmake >=2.8.9 & < 2.8.12. Kube already requires cmake 3.0. One advantage of using the imported targets is, that cmake complains if a target isn't found before it's used, like Qt5Concurrent missing from the find_package_call here.
